Facelift
One of the most obvious signs of aging is the gradual sagging and wrinkling of the face. Skin loses its firmness and elasticity, and environmental factors cause general deterioration. Dr. Toohey can reduce the appearance of aging in the lower two-thirds of the face by performing a facelift. (See photos)
Through incisions placed around the ear and within the hairline, excess skin and underlying tissue can be removed and the remaining skin and tissue gently smoothed and tightened. Dr. Toohey’s skill and experience can leave your face looking years younger, without looking unnaturally taut. (See photos)
Brow Lift
A sagging, furrowed forehead can make a person look angry, sinister, or just tired. A brow lift from Dr. Toohey can do for the forehead what a facelift does for the lower two-thirds of the face: restore a youthful, rested appearance. Depending on the individual circumstances, Dr. Toohey usually performs an endoscopic brow lift, which rejuvenates the appearance without resulting in a surprised look to the face. (See photos)
In a standard brow lift, an incision is made at the hairline and excess skin and underlying tissue is removed. The remaining skin is gently pulled upward and sutured, resulting in a flat, smooth surface.
In other cases of wrinkling and sagging, Dr. Toohey may perform an endoscopic brow lift, in which tiny incisions are made in the skin, through which tissue is lifted, tightened, and fastened into place. Smoothing the underlying tissue allows the skin above to smooth out, and the healing time from this procedure is much shorter than with a standard brow lift; suspension is the key. (See photos)
Blepharoplasty
Wrinkling and sagging in the area around the eyes can add years to a person’s appearance and even impair vision. Puffiness or sagging below the eyes can make a person look old and tired. The same is true of the eyelids, which can also droop enough to partially block the field of vision. Blepharoplasty is the general term for procedures performed in the area around the eyes to correct these problems.
To reduce puffiness and sagging under the eyes, Dr. Toohey can remove excess skin and fat. To restore a youthful, rested appearance to the eyelid, an incision can be made in the crease above the eye. Once excess skin has been removed, the eyelid will also be tighter and smoother, keeping it well clear of the field of vision.
In rare cases in which drooping eyelids are the cause of significant loss of vision, eyelid surgery may be covered by health insurance, but only if prescribed by an ophthalmologist.

Otoplasty
Ears that are noticeably larger than average or protrude from the side of the head can distract from the rest of a person’s appearance and be a source of embarrassment. This is especially true for children, who are often teased to the point of emotional distress. Dr. Toohey can skillfully perform ear refinement, also known as otoplasty, to reduce the size of the ear or to reduce the angle of protrusion.
Otoplasty is usually performed on children only after they reach the age of 14, the age at which the permanent size and shape of the ear is usually established. Injectable Facial Treatments
Dr. Toohey can provide a number of popular injectable treatments that offer a minimally invasive way to achieve smoother, younger-looking skin. These treatments include BOTOX® Cosmetic, collagen, RESTYLANE®, and fat transfers.
BOTOX® Cosmetic is one of the best-known injectables. It is a protein that blocks nerve signals to muscles that contract the skin to form wrinkles. It is especially effective on forehead wrinkles and crow’s feet, relaxing them away.
Collagen is a substance that forms a supportive network just below the surface of the skin. As it is lost over time, the skin sags and wrinkles. Dr. Toohey can provide injections of new collagen to temporarily replace the old and lift the skin from below, smoothing out lines and wrinkles.
RESTYLANE® is an inert gel that can be injected under the skin to plump up and fill in wrinkles. It is made from a naturally occurring chemical substance and is non-allergenic.
Fat transfer is another method of filling in lines, wrinkles, and hollow areas of the face. As we age, healthy fat under the facial skin dissipates. In some areas, it causes sagging, which leads to lines and wrinkles. In other areas, although the skin may still be smooth, fullness is lost, leading to a sunken look. Injecting fat taken from other parts of the body can fill in and smooth the face, taking years off your appearance.
None of the treatments listed above is a permanent solution. The body eventually absorbs the materials used. Dr. Toohey can tell you which treatment is most appropriate to your individual needs.
